O R D E R
This petition has been filed to direct the first respondent to forward the complaint dated 08.01.2016 to the second respondent and further direct the second respondent to register an FIR upon the same and take action as per law.
2.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ate(Crl.Side) appearing for the State.
3. Learned Government Advocate (Crl.Side) submits that, on the complaint dated 08.01.2016 given by the petitioner, petition enquiry was conducted and the same was closed on 16.03.2016 and a copy of the Closure Report has been served to the learned counsel for the petitioner across the bar.

4. Recording the same, this petition is closed with liberty to the petitioner to workout her remedy in the manner known to law.
